Transaction ef93e74fb169ae4c42a106e1fd49f78924347391fd18249410d510a4152f39f3
1 Input
1 Output
-
ef93e74fb169ae4c42a106e1fd49f78924347391fd18249410d510a4152f39f3:0
- value
- 466788
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 86d9d7522ba8d39871dc59defdb4e767b30db819 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DJ2Wa4mTC5MwUwUXeTLXrJfghoXAYffvc